How Much is a Shot of Patron Tequila? A Comprehensive Guide to Pricing
Patron tequila is a premium brand, known for its smooth taste and high quality. But how much does a single shot actually cost? The price can vary significantly depending on several factors. This guide will delve into the details, helping you understand what influences the cost of a Patron shot and what you can expect to pay.
Factors Affecting the Price of a Patron Tequila Shot
Several factors contribute to the fluctuating price of a Patron shot. Understanding these factors will allow you to make more informed decisions when ordering.
Type of Patron Tequila:
Patron offers a range of tequilas, from their entry-level Patron Silver to their top-shelf Patron Añejo and Patron Extra Añejo. The ageing process significantly impacts the cost. Añejos and Extra Añejos, aged for longer periods, command higher prices due to their complexity and smoother taste. Therefore, a shot of Patron Añejo will be more expensive than a shot of Patron Silver.
Location:
The location where you purchase your Patron shot plays a crucial role in pricing. Upscale bars and clubs in major cities will typically charge more for a shot than a smaller, local bar. Tourist destinations also tend to have higher prices. Consider the establishment's overall atmosphere and target market when assessing price.
Time of Day/Week:
Prices can fluctuate depending on the time of day and day of the week. Happy hour specials might offer discounted prices, while peak hours on weekends often see higher prices. Check for daily or weekly specials to potentially save money.
Portion Size:
While a "shot" generally refers to a 1.5-ounce serving, some establishments may offer slightly larger or smaller portions. Always clarify the size of the shot to ensure you're getting what you expect and avoid any surprises on the bill.
Average Price Range for a Shot of Patron Tequila
Given the variability mentioned above, providing an exact price is challenging. However, you can generally expect to pay within a certain range:
- Patron Silver: $10 - $20
- Patron Reposado: $12 - $25
- Patron Añejo: $15 - $30
- Patron Extra Añejo: $20 - $40+
These are estimates, and actual prices can be higher or lower depending on the factors outlined above.
Tips for Saving Money on Patron Tequila
If you're looking to enjoy Patron tequila without breaking the bank, consider these tips:
- Look for Happy Hour Specials: Many bars and restaurants offer discounted drinks during happy hour.
- Visit Local Bars: Smaller, local establishments often have more affordable prices compared to high-end venues.
- Consider Ordering a Bottle: Buying a bottle might be more cost-effective if you're planning on having multiple shots. (Always drink responsibly!)
- Check Online Reviews: See if others have mentioned prices at specific locations to get an idea beforehand.
